  • Patent number: 4958243
    Abstract: Phase discrimination and data separation method and apparatus for on-track error recovery by shifting input data in time relative to a clock to improve recovery of error bits due to bit shift in a disk storage system having a servo clock syncronized to a disk's rotational speed and a refernce clock which must be synchronized to the servo clock to insure that the data previously written onto the disk will be retrieved correctly during read back. Data encoded in (1,7) or denser codes can be recovered because of fewer transitions in a phase discriminator and therefore a shortened phase discrimination cycle in a feedback loop to avoid interference into the following correction. Readback data pulses for address mark (AM) search operations are standardized while a PLL is phase locked to the servo data, reducing or eliminating misdetection of AM due to delay skew or pulse width variations. Sequential logic avoids race conditions.

  • Patent number: 4726022
    Abstract: A system for controllably varying the width of the data window in a magnetic storage device to perform comparative data detection error rate measurements thereon is provided. The system generates the programmably and continuously variable stressed data window symmetrically within, and in locked phase with, the full data window under the control of a single current DAC in the VCO of the device.
